President Donald Trump blasted the Supreme Court to their face during his State of the Union address following their recent ruling against his tariff plan. During his speech at the U.S. Capitol on Tuesday, Feb. 24, the president made several pointed remarks at the members of the Supreme Court. Only four justices were present Chief Justice John Roberts and Associate Justices Elena Kagan, Brett Kavanaugh, and Amy Coney Barrett but that didn't stop Trump from criticizing the court as a whole for their decision. "It was an unfortunate ruling from the United States Supreme Court, a very unfortunate ruling," Trump said, while the four present justices sat in the front row.
snip...
The president praised the three dissenting justices Kavanaugh, Samuel Alito and Clarence Thomas but called those who voted for the majority "a disgrace to our nation." He reserved his sharpest insults for Coney Barrett and Neil Gorsuch the two Trump appointees who voted against his tariffs calling them "an embarrassment to their families.
"It's my opinion that the court has been swayed by foreign interests," he continued. "It's almost like [the decision was] written by not very smart people." Five of the nine Supreme Court justices skipped Trump's 2026 State of the Union address: Republican-appointed justices Alito, Thomas and Gorsuch, as well as Democrat-appointed justices Sonia Sotomayor and Ketanji Brown Jackson.
